2024 NOK to BDT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2024

During 2024, the NOK to BDT ex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 24, valuing the pair at 11.5003.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 30, dropping to 9.8744.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1.6259 BDT.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 10.5521 to the December average rate of 10.6382, the exchange rate registered a net change of 0.82%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2024 high of 11.5003 was up 5.20% compared to the 2023 peak of 10.9323,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

NOK to BDT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 10.5211, compared to 10.9508 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.4297 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2024 was May, with a trading range of 1.2488 BDT (High: 11.1936 / Low: 9.9448). On the other end, February was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.2328 BDT (High: 10.5074 / Low: 10.2746).

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between April and June,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 2 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between March and April, when the average rate fell by 0.2742 points.

Same-Month Historical Baseline

YoY Baseline

Comparing the current year's strongest month average (September 2024: 11.2668) against the same month in 2023 (average: 10.2328), the exchange rate shifted by +1.0341 (+10.11%).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 10.8054 10.4160 10.5521
February 10.5074 10.2746 10.4046
March 10.5299 10.1059 10.3333
April 10.2846 9.8744 10.0591
May 11.1936 9.9448 10.7100
June 11.2313 10.9678 11.0674
July 11.1363 10.6528 10.8829
August 11.4253 10.6222 11.0516
September 11.5003 11.0020 11.2668
October 11.2964 10.8596 11.0477
November 10.9886 10.6883 10.8176
December 10.8345 10.4464 10.6382
